Load control device for a light-emitting diode light source

1. A load control device for controlling an amount of power delivered to an electrical load, the load control device comprising:

  • a load regulation circuit configured to control a magnitude of a load current conducted through the electrical load to control the amount of power delivered to the electrical load; and

    a control circuit coupled to the load regulation circuit and configured to adjust an average magnitude of the load current, wherein the control circuit is configured to operate in a normal mode to regulate the average magnitude of the load current to a target load current that ranges from a maximum rated current to a minimum rated current, the control circuit further configured to operate in a burst mode to regulate the average magnitude of the load current below the minimum rated current;

    wherein, during the burst mode, the control circuit is configured to regulate a peak magnitude of the load current to the minimum rated current during a first time period using a control loop, and to stop regulating the load current during a second time period resulting in the average magnitude of the load current being below the minimum rated current, the control circuit configured to freeze the control loop during the second time period.
